What makes this app unique?
Users hire this app for convenient access to worship scores during church services, replacing physical binders with a digital, gesture-enabled interface.
For Christian musicians, choir directors, and worshipers across various denominations including Baptist, Methodist, Pentecostal, and Seventh-day Adventist.

How much does it cost?
The app utilizes a direct purchase model on iOS at $3.99, while the Android version is free, likely monetized through ad inventory.

How's the Music market?
The app sits at #81 Paid in the French Music category, having dropped 24 spots recently. The lack of search functionality and UI rendering issues on standard hardware limit its ability to compete with category leaders.

Where is it heading?
The digital sheet music market is consolidating around platforms that offer community-driven libraries and cross-platform sync. Without active feature investment, this app remains exposed to churn as users migrate to more robust, free alternatives.
- UI rendering regressions and missing search functionality erode the daily active habit, which compounds the rating drag already visible on the platform.
